I checked your site and the main thing I would suggest is to separate “file access” from the normal content pages. The pages can explain the files, but the actual downloads should be handled with proper rules.

For a safe setup, use clear file categories, limit access if needed, keep download logs, and avoid letting users upload or download anything without checks. If the files are only for learning, it is also good to add short notes explaining what each file is, who should use it, and what risks or rules apply.

For security, I’d also avoid public folders with direct file browsing enabled. Use protected download links, scan files before uploading, keep backups, and make sure users cannot access private folders by guessing URLs.

A simple structure works best: guide page, file description, download button, access rules, and basic safety notes. That keeps the site useful without making file access messy or risky.
